MORNSUN recommends a PCB layout with a large copper area connected to the tab of the device, and multiple vias to dissipate heat. A minimum of 2oz copper thickness is recommended.
Yes, the LD15-23B24R2 is designed to withstand vibrations up to 10G peak acceleration, but it's recommended to follow MORNSUN's guidelines for vibration testing and ensure proper PCB mounting and screwing.
MORNSUN recommends following the CISPR 22 Class B standard for EMC, and using a metal enclosure, proper grounding, and filtering to minimize EMI emissions.
MORNSUN recommends a maximum output capacitance of 220uF to ensure stability and prevent oscillations. Exceeding this value may lead to instability or damage to the converter.
Yes, the LD15-23B24R2 is designed to operate up to 5000m altitude, but derating may be necessary for high-altitude applications. Consult MORNSUN's application notes for guidance.
